Diversifying Income: The New Metric of Success

The days of measuring success purely by box office earnings are gone. Today, the most profitable actors are those who diversify their income streams. This includes contracts with streaming platforms, production deals, and extensive marketing strategies.

Real-Life Example: Dwayne Johnson

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son has been a pioneer in this regard. His historical contract with Amazon for the film "Red One" included a record-breaking $50 million salary for both acting and production. Despite the film’s modest cinema reception, its success on Amazon Prime Video cemented Johnson’s status as a top entertainer. His role in "Moana 2" further reinforced this trend, as Disney offered him a percentage of the benefits for the first time, ensuring additional income and solidifying his industry dominance.

Actor/Actress Income in 2024 (USD) Notable Projects/Deals Diversification Strategy
Dwayne Johnson 50 million "Red One," "Moana 2" Streaming deals, production roles
Ryan Reynolds 50 million "Deadpool & Wolverine" Production, co-founder roles
Kevin Hart 81 million "Borderlands," "Lift," "Die Hart 2" Multiple projects, stand-up, advertising campaigns
Jerry Seinfeld 30 million "Seinfeld" syndication, "Unfrosted" Syndication, new projects
Hugh Jackman 50 million "Deadpool & Wolverine" Acting, production roles
Brad Pitt 31 million "Wolfs" Acting, production, beverage business
Nicole Kidman 31 million "The Perfect Couple," "Babygirl" Streaming series, movie roles
Adam Sandler 26 million "Spaceman," "Happy Gilmore" sequel Exclusive streaming deals
Will Smith 26 million Various new projects Legacy, new projects
